Cauliflower is a cruciferous vegetable that is closely related to broccoli, Brussels sprouts, and cabbage. It is a versatile vegetable that can be enjoyed raw or cooked and is often used as a substitute for rice or potatoes in low-carb diets.
Cauliflower is low in calories and high in fiber, making it a great choice for those looking to maintain a healthy diet. It is also a good source of vitamins C and K, and is rich in antioxidants and phytonutrients, which have been linked to a range of health benefits, including reducing the risk of certain cancers and heart disease.
There are many ways to enjoy cauliflower. It can be eaten raw in salads or dips, roasted, grilled, steamed, or boiled. It can also be mashed or pureed to make a creamy and delicious alternative to mashed potatoes. Cauliflower is often used in soups, stews, and curries, and is a popular ingredient in dishes such as cauliflower pizza crust and cauliflower "rice."
